]> git.apps.os.sepia.ceph.com Git - ceph-ci.git/commitdiff
Merge pull request #19255 from JianyuLi/joa-mdbalancer
authorYan, Zheng <ukernel@gmail.com>
Tue, 26 Dec 2017 08:46:17 +0000 (16:46 +0800)
committerGitHub <noreply@github.com>
Tue, 26 Dec 2017 08:46:17 +0000 (16:46 +0800)
MDS: make rebalancer evaluate the overload state of each mds with the same criterion

1  2 
src/mds/MDBalancer.cc
src/mds/MDBalancer.h

index ac4e17e099513cdee93c8fb5d055a16e7d7d42b4,d7fdf561bc3d8ca8032ac9441519c3988a9df318..14b930c8a6e9bf43636d91a54515fe9c6d7c8c60
@@@ -397,7 -384,10 +397,8 @@@ void MDBalancer::handle_heartbeat(MHear
      }
    }
    mds_import_map[ who ] = m->get_import_map();
+   mds_last_epoch_under_info[who] = m->get_last_epoch_under();
  
 -  //dout(0) << "  load is " << load << " have " << mds_load.size() << dendl;
 -
    {
      unsigned cluster_size = mds->get_mds_map()->get_num_in_mds();
      if (mds_load.size() == cluster_size) {
Simple merge